The Travel Score for the Lung Cancer Score in 17935, Girardville, Pennsylvania is 30 when comparing 34,000 ZIP Codes in the United States.
62.35 percent of residents in 17935 to travel to work in 30 minutes or less.
When looking at the three closest hospitals, the average distance to a hospital is 13.31 miles. The closest hospital with an emergency room is Schuylkill Medical Center - South Jackson Street with a distance of 9.06 miles from the area.

**Driving Distances and Roadways:**
Girardville's location in Schuylkill County presents both advantages and challenges regarding healthcare access. The primary advantage is the relatively straightforward access to major roadways. However, the rural nature of the area dictates that residents often rely on personal vehicles.
The nearest major medical facilities offering comprehensive lung cancer care are located in Pottsville, approximately 10 miles away. The drive, primarily via **Route 54** and **Route 61**, typically takes between 15 and 25 minutes, depending on traffic and weather conditions. This drive time represents a moderate level of accessibility.
For more specialized care, such as advanced radiation therapy or clinical trials, patients may need to travel to larger hospitals in Reading (approximately 50 miles) or Allentown (approximately 75 miles). The journey to Reading involves navigating **Interstate 81** to **Route 61** and then **Route 222**. This drive could take up to an hour and a half, significantly impacting healthcare access. Allentown requires a longer trip, utilizing **Interstate 81** to **Interstate 78**, potentially taking up to two hours. This longer travel time poses a considerable challenge for patients requiring frequent appointments or experiencing debilitating symptoms.
The quality of these roadways is generally good, but winter weather can significantly impact travel times and safety. Snow and ice can create hazardous driving conditions, potentially delaying or even preventing access to essential medical appointments. This weather factor adds another layer of complexity to the assessment of healthcare access.
**Public Transportation Challenges:**
Public transportation options in Girardville are limited. The Schuylkill Transportation System (STS) provides some bus services, but these routes are infrequent and primarily serve the larger towns in the county. There is no direct bus route to any of the major hospitals offering lung cancer care in Pottsville, Reading, or Allentown.
The lack of robust public transportation poses a significant barrier to healthcare access for those who cannot drive, including the elderly, individuals with disabilities, and those without personal vehicles. The absence of convenient and reliable public transit negatively impacts the "Lung Cancer Score."
Furthermore, the STS buses may not all be fully ADA-compliant, potentially creating accessibility challenges for individuals with mobility limitations. This lack of ADA-compliant features further restricts healthcare access for a vulnerable population.
